That the Parliament commends the Blue Door charity in Kirkwall, Orkney, on raising £19,216.55 for UNICEF's Ukraine appeal; understands that the Blue Door fundraised £9,828.23 on 6 March 2022 through activities such as a bottle stall, bake sale and face painting and has since raised this amount to £19,216.55 through a raffle with donations from a large number of Orkney businesses, groups and individuals; further understands that the money will be donated to UNICEF, which, it understands, is working tirelessly to help provide humanitarian aid to Ukraine's 7.5 million children and their families; understands that the Blue Door shop in Kirkwall is offered rent free to different Orkney-based groups, organisations and charities each week and has raised over £1.7 million for good causes since it was established in 2003; applauds the many local businesses and individuals who donated towards the Blue Door's raffle, and thanks the wider community in Orkney for what it sees as their outstanding generosity for Ukraine, with over £28,000 being fundraised since the war began.
